Summary Tech giants like Nvidia, Microsoft and Google are introducing new chips, software and technologies to power AI agents that can autonomously handle complex tasks.
Nvidia revealed its RTX Spark chip for laptops that can run AI agents without cloud connectivity, while Microsoft announced Scout for Microsoft 365. Experts say widespread adoption faces hurdles including high costs and trust issues, though the technology shows promise for business applications.
New York For at least a decade, tech giants have tried to develop computers that can handle complicated tasks on a userâs behalf.
But those efforts have largely fallen flat, with assistants like Alexa and Siri mostly being used for things like setting alarms and playing music.
Some of the worldâs biggest tech companies are betting thatâs about to change.
